Web27 dec. 2016 · 4.2 The hydraulic conductivity of porous materials generally decreases with an increasing amount of air in the pores of the material. These test methods apply to water-saturated porous materials containing virtually no air. 4.3 These test methods apply to permeation of porous materials with water. Web14 apr. 2024 · Nuclear magnetic resonance (NMR) logging is a promising method for estimating hydraulic conductivity (K). During the past ~60 years, NMR logging has been used for petroleum applications, and different models have been developed for deriving estimates of permeability. WebThe horizontal hydraulic-conductivity values ranged from 0.001 to 130 m/d with geometric and arithmetic means of 2 m/d and 11 m/d, respectively. Web27 aug. 2015 · The hydraulic conductivity derived from the pumping tests covered a lower range of values (10 −6 –10 −5 m/s) than did those calculated using the injection tests. No particular trend was evident from the comparison of the values of hydraulic conductivity obtained for piezometers located in different directions from the pumped well.
